Abstract Mechanical ventilation is any method in which an apparatus is used to assist breathing. In the recent decades a great advance had been achieved in the field of mechanical ventilation leading to a marked increase in the frequency of its usage However the weaning from the ventilator is a great challenge for all intensivists . Many studies had been conducted to describe modes and strategies of wearing as well as to monitor complications associating the process of wearing The present study was conducted to investigate the incidence and significance of myocardial ischemia during the wearing period . Previous studies had suggested that myocardial ischemia might be a cause of failure of wearing specially in patients with previous history of coronary artery disease The study was carried out during a six months period in the critical care unit III , Alexandria main university hospital. It included 102 mechanically ventilated patients with different diagnosis. The wearing decision, mode and patient management were decision of the treating physician |
